Job Summary
DPR Construction is seeking a MEP Superintendent with 5 or more years of commercial mechanical, electrical, and plumbing construction experience. The role involves managing day‑to‑day scheduling and field coordination of mechanical, electrical, plumbing, fire/life safety, low‑voltage, and fire sprinkler scopes; collaborating with project executives and regional leadership; and leading system start‑up, test‑and‑balance, and commissioning.
Responsibilities- Review trade partner proposals, schedules, and logistics.
- Manage installation of electrical, HVAC, automation, plumbing, process piping, low‑voltage, fire/life safety, and fire protection systems.
- Participate in review of MEP shop drawings and submittals.
- Assist in developing full commissioning plans for all MEP systems, including test requirements, inspections, factory start‑up, acceptance testing, documentation, and integrated test plans.
- Provide onsite construction support, overseeing start‑up, balancing, commissioning, and validation certification, including owner training and project close‑out.
- Develop and oversee project‑specific MEP quality and safety programs and contribute to safety event analysis.
- Create and update construction schedules, monitor logic, and adjust activities as needed.
- Coordinate jobsite logistics and maintain relationships with neighboring occupants.
- Negotiate with authorities having jurisdiction to achieve occupancy milestones.
- Lead DPR’s injury‑free safety program.
- Coordinate subcontractor work scopes, scheduling, and resource loading in conjunction with DPR’s self‑perform crews.
- Foster development of foremen into future superintendents.
- Represent DPR field operations as the primary interface with owners and design teams.
